易支付作为免签约支付解决方案的核心优势,在于能快速打通 “用户付款 - 订单同步 - 权益交付” 闭环,尤其适配在线课程、软件激活码这类 “即时交付、权限绑定” 的数字商品场景。以下从场景化配置、核心功能落地、风险防控三个维度,提供可直接复用的收款方案,兼顾个人开发者与中小型平台需求。
在线课程需解决 “试看引流→付费解锁→课程学习” 的连贯体验,易支付可通过 “支付回调 + 接口联动” 实现权限自动开通,无需人工干预。
第一步:商品与支付绑定在易支付商户后台创建 “课程类商品”,按 “单课(99 元)、系列课(299 元)、会员包(599 元 / 年)” 设置定价,填写课程名称(如 “Python 入门到精通”)、简介(“10 节视频课 + 课件下载”),并关联支付通道(微信 / 支付宝扫码 / H5 支付)。关键设置:开启 “支付后触发回调”,填写课程平台的 “权限开通接口地址”(如https://xxx.com/course/notify),用于同步支付结果。
第二步:试看与付费衔接课程平台前端设置 “试看入口”(试看前 2 节或 5 分钟内容),试看结束后弹出 “解锁完整课程” 弹窗,点击后跳转至易支付定制化支付页 —— 支付页需突出 “支付后立即开通全部课程”“支持 7 天未观看退款” 提示,降低用户决策成本。示例支付页参数:subject=Python入门到精通(单课)&attach={"course_id":101,"user_id":5001}(attach字段携带课程 ID 与用户 ID,回调时用于精准开通权限)。
第三步:回调与权限开通用户支付成功后,易支付向 “权限开通接口” 发送 POST 回调,包含订单号、支付状态、attach字段等信息。课程平台接收到回调后,执行以下逻辑:
验证回调签名(用易支付api_key校验,防止伪造请求);
解析attach字段,获取用户 ID 与课程 ID;
调用课程系统接口,将用户 ID 与课程 ID 绑定,开通 “视频观看、课件下载” 权限;
向用户发送短信 / 邮件通知(“您已成功购买 Python 课程,点击链接立即学习”)。
软件激活码需实现 “支付后秒级发码、单码单设备绑定”,易支付可结合 “激活码库存管理 + 回调发码” 功能,避免人工发码延迟与激活码滥用。
第一步:激活码库存预处理在易支付商户后台创建 “激活码类商品”,设置商品名称(如 “XX 软件终身激活码”)、定价(199 元),并通过 “批量导入” 功能上传激活码库存(支持 TXT/Excel 格式,每行 1 个激活码,如 “ABC1234567890”)。关键设置:勾选 “自动扣减库存”,设置 “单激活码绑定 1 个设备指纹”,防止多设备重复激活。
第二步:支付与发码流程软件官网 / 客户端的 “激活码购买” 入口跳转至易支付支付页,用户选择支付方式(微信 / 支付宝)完成付款后,易支付触发双重交付:
即时发码:通过短信 / 邮件向用户预留的联系方式发送激活码(如 “您的 XX 软件激活码:ABC1234567890,有效期至 2028 年 12 月 31 日”);
页面展示:支付成功跳转页同步显示激活码,搭配 “激活教程” 链接(如 “打开软件→设置→激活→输入激活码”),避免用户漏收。
第三步:激活验证与防滥用用户在软件中输入激活码后,软件后台向易支付 “激活验证接口” 发起请求,验证激活码有效性:
校验激活码是否存在、未被使用;
记录激活设备的指纹信息(如电脑 CPU 序列号、手机 IMEI);
若激活码已被其他设备使用,返回 “激活码已失效” 提示;若验证通过,标记激活码为 “已使用”,并绑定当前设备。
品牌化适配:在易支付商户后台上传课程 / 软件 LOGO,定制支付页配色(与官网风格一致),避免用户因 “页面风格突变” 产生不信任感。
小额免密优化:针对≤50 元的课程 / 激活码,开启 “微信小额免密支付”,用户无需输入密码即可完成付款,缩短支付路径(数据显示可提升 15% 转化)。
支付方式智能推荐:根据用户终端自动排序支付方式 —— 微信内打开优先显示 “微信支付”,浏览器打开优先显示 “支付宝扫码”,减少用户选择成本。
多端订单同步:易支付商户后台、课程平台、软件管理系统三方同步订单数据,包含 “订单号、用户信息、支付金额、交付状态”,支持按 “支付时间、商品类型” 筛选,方便对账与售后。
退款自动化:针对在线课程 “7 天未观看退款”、激活码 “未激活退款” 场景,在易支付后台设置 “自动退款规则”—— 用户申请退款后,系统自动校验 “课程观看时长 / 激活码使用状态”,符合条件则 1 小时内原路退款,无需人工审核。
SDK 与接口文档:易支付提供 PHP/Java/Python/Node.js 多语言 SDK,可直接集成到课程平台 / 软件后台,SDK 下载地址:易支付开发者中心 - 工具下载(需替换为实际官方地址)。
测试环境:开启易支付 “测试模式”,使用测试金额(0.01 元)模拟支付流程,验证 “支付 - 回调 - 交付” 全链路,无需真实付款。
售后支持:易支付提供 7×24 小时技术支持(QQ:123456789),针对课程权限开通失败、激活码发码延迟等问题,可 10 分钟内响应处理。
通过这套方案,无论是在线课程的 “权限开通” 还是软件激活码的 “自动发码”,都能实现全自动化收款交付,既提升用户体验,又降低人工成本与风险,适配从个人开发者到中小型企业的数字商品收款需求。